ListSnapshot
È possibile utilizzare ListSnapshots
per restituire gli attributi di ogni snapshot acquisito sul volume.
Le informazioni sugli snapshot che risiedono nel cluster di destinazione verranno visualizzate nel cluster di origine quando questo metodo viene chiamato dal cluster di origine.
Parametri
Questo metodo ha i seguenti parametri di input:
Nome | Descrizione | Tipo | Valore predefinito | Obbligatorio |
---|---|---|---|---|
ID volume |
Recupera le snapshot di un volume. Se volumeID non viene fornito, vengono restituiti tutti gli snapshot per tutti i volumi. |
intero |
Nessuno |
No |
SnapshotID |
Recupera le informazioni per un singolo ID snapshot. |
intero |
Nessuno |
No |
Valore restituito
Questo metodo ha il seguente valore restituito:
Nome | Descrizione | Tipo |
---|---|---|
snapshot |
Informazioni su ogni snapshot per ciascun volume. Se volumeID non viene fornito, vengono restituiti tutti gli snapshot per tutti i volumi. Gli snapshot di un gruppo vengono restituiti con un ID di gruppo. |
snapshot array |
Esempio di richiesta
Le richieste per questo metodo sono simili all'esempio seguente:
{ "method": "ListSnapshots", "params": { "volumeID": "1" }, "id" : 1 }
Esempio di risposta
Questo metodo restituisce una risposta simile all'esempio seguente:
{ "id": 1, "result": { "snapshots": [ { "attributes": {}, "checksum": "0x0", "createTime": "2015-05-08T13:15:00Z", "enableRemoteReplication": true, "expirationReason": "None", "expirationTime": "2015-05-08T21:15:00Z", "groupID": 0, "groupSnapshotUUID": "00000000-0000-0000-0000-000000000000", "name": "Hourly", "remoteStatuses": [ { "remoteStatus": "Present", "volumePairUUID": "237e1cf9-fb4a-49de-a089-a6a9a1f0361e" } ], "snapshotID": 572, "snapshotUUID": "efa98e40-cb36-4c20-a090-a36c48296c14", "status": "done", "totalSize": 10000269312, "volumeID": 1 } ] } }
Novità dalla versione
9,6